Welcome to TIGRIS Virtual Lab Project Area
KNOWLEDGE FROM ANCIENT MESOPOTAMIA:
OPEN ACCESS AND CROWDSOURCING
Project aim is to give Open Access to Knowledge hidden in cuneiform texts, sharing with the Assyriological Community Language e-Resources, extracted from collected corpora transliteration (with lemmatization and grammatical tagging).
ENEA TIGRIS V-Lab is now testing some Text Analysis and Mining functionalities on assyriological corpora. The main idea is that of opening access to knowledge hosted in assyriological texts and data, by producing and sharing knowledge extracted from data and research outputs.

MULTILINGUAL TEXT MINING
Within the TIGRIS Project the task of Text Mining is performed using TalTaC2 (Automatic Lexical and Textual Processing for the Analysis of Content"). TalTaC2 is a software application of the University of Rome “La Sapienza” for the automatic analysis of texts, according to the logics of Text Analysis (TA) and Text Mining (TM).
TalTac2 extracts the vocabulary of the corpus and produces: lists of terms, frequencies, concordances, fusion of the categorized terms by lemmas or by classes of categories (set of verbs/adjectives), reconstruction of the texts with grammatical or semantic categorization of the text, etc.
